
The ketogenic diet, or keto diet, is a high-fat, low-carbohydrate eating plan that shifts the body into a state of ketosis, where it burns fat for energy instead of glucose. While it has gained popularity for weight loss and managing certain health conditions, it is not suitable for everyone. Individuals with certain medical conditions, such as pancreatitis, liver conditions, or fat metabolism disorders, should avoid the keto diet, as it can exacerbate these issues. Pregnant or breastfeeding women, people with a history of eating disorders, and those with type 1 diabetes or kidney disease should also steer clear, as the diet may pose significant health risks. Additionally, individuals who are underweight or have a history of disordered eating should consult a healthcare professional before considering keto, as it may not meet their nutritional needs or could trigger unhealthy behaviors.

Pregnant or breastfeeding women: High-fat diets may impact fetal development and milk production
Pregnant and breastfeeding women often seek optimal nutrition to support their health and their child’s development, but the keto diet’s high-fat, low-carb framework may disrupt this delicate balance. During pregnancy, fetal development relies on a steady supply of glucose, which the keto diet restricts, potentially limiting the brain and organ growth that depend on this energy source. Breastfeeding women, meanwhile, require adequate glycogen stores to sustain milk production, a process that can be compromised by ketosis. While some fats are essential for fetal brain development, the keto diet’s extreme macronutrient ratios may tip the scale toward nutrient deficiencies or excesses, posing risks to both mother and child.
Consider the metabolic demands of pregnancy and lactation: the body prioritizes glucose utilization for fetal growth and milk synthesis. A keto diet, by design, shifts the body into ketosis, where fat becomes the primary energy source instead of carbohydrates. This metabolic shift can reduce glucose availability, potentially impairing placental function or decreasing milk volume. For instance, studies suggest that low maternal glucose levels may correlate with reduced fetal growth rates, while inadequate milk production can lead to infant malnutrition. Breastfeeding women on keto may also experience a drop in milk supply due to depleted glycogen stores, which are critical for lactose synthesis.
Practical concerns further underscore why pregnant or breastfeeding women should avoid keto. The diet’s restrictive nature often limits intake of nutrient-dense foods like fruits, starchy vegetables, and whole grains, which provide essential vitamins, minerals, and fiber. Folate, found in fortified grains and leafy greens, is crucial for preventing neural tube defects in early pregnancy, yet keto’s carb restrictions may reduce intake. Similarly, breastfeeding women need an additional 500 calories daily, primarily from balanced macronutrients, to support milk production—a need keto’s rigid structure struggles to meet. Instead, focus on a diet rich in lean proteins, healthy fats, and complex carbohydrates to ensure adequate nutrient intake.
For those in this life stage, the risks of keto far outweigh potential benefits. Pregnant women should aim for a diet that includes 175–240 grams of carbohydrates daily to support fetal development, while breastfeeding women require at least 210 grams to maintain energy levels and milk supply. Incorporating foods like whole grains, legumes, and dairy ensures a steady glucose supply without triggering ketosis. Consulting a healthcare provider or registered dietitian can help tailor a plan that meets individual needs, ensuring both mother and child thrive during these critical periods. Individuals with pancreatic issues: Keto can worsen pancreatitis due to high fat intake
Pancreatitis, an inflammation of the pancreas, demands a careful approach to diet, and the keto diet's high-fat content can exacerbate this condition. The pancreas plays a critical role in fat digestion by producing enzymes that break down dietary fats. When fat intake is excessively high, as is typical in a keto diet (often 70-80% of daily calories from fat), the pancreas is forced to work overtime. For individuals with pre-existing pancreatic issues, this increased workload can trigger or worsen acute pancreatitis, leading to severe abdominal pain, nausea, and potential long-term damage.
Consider the mechanism: a keto diet relies on fats as the primary energy source, drastically reducing carbohydrate intake. While this shift can be beneficial for some, it places immense strain on the pancreas. Studies show that high-fat diets are associated with a higher risk of pancreatitis, particularly in those with a history of pancreatic disorders. For example, a 2018 study published in the *Journal of Clinical Gastroenterology* found that patients with chronic pancreatitis experienced flare-ups when consuming diets high in fat. This underscores the importance of avoiding keto if you have pancreatic issues.
If you’ve been diagnosed with pancreatitis or have a history of pancreatic problems, consult a healthcare professional before considering any high-fat diet. Instead of keto, focus on a low-fat, balanced diet that includes lean proteins, whole grains, and plenty of fruits and vegetables. Aim for no more than 20-30% of your daily calories from fat, and avoid saturated and trans fats altogether. Practical tips include using cooking methods like baking or steaming instead of frying, choosing low-fat dairy products, and incorporating healthy fats in moderation, such as those from avocados or nuts.
The takeaway is clear: for individuals with pancreatic issues, the keto diet’s high-fat foundation poses a significant risk. Prioritize pancreatic health by opting for a diet that minimizes fat intake and supports overall digestive function. People with liver conditions: Increased fat metabolism may strain an already compromised liver
The liver is a metabolic powerhouse, processing fats, proteins, and carbohydrates to fuel the body. For those with liver conditions like cirrhosis, non-alcoholic fatty liver disease (NAFLD), or hepatitis, the ketogenic diet’s reliance on high-fat intake can be a double-edged sword. While keto shifts the body into ketosis, burning fat for energy, this process places additional strain on an already compromised liver, potentially exacerbating existing damage.
Consider the mechanics: during ketosis, the liver converts dietary and stored fats into ketones, a process that demands significant enzymatic activity and energy expenditure. For a healthy liver, this is manageable. However, in individuals with liver disease, the organ’s ability to metabolize fats efficiently is often impaired. Increased fat intake, a cornerstone of keto, can overwhelm the liver, leading to fat accumulation and worsening conditions like NAFLD. Studies suggest that prolonged high-fat diets may elevate liver enzymes (e.g., ALT and AST), markers of liver stress, in susceptible individuals.
Practical caution is essential. If you have a liver condition, consult a hepatologist or dietitian before attempting keto. Monitoring liver function tests regularly is critical, as is adjusting macronutrient ratios to reduce fat intake if symptoms worsen. For example, a modified low-fat, high-protein diet may be safer, though individual tolerance varies. Age and severity of liver disease also play a role; older adults or those with advanced cirrhosis may face higher risks.
The takeaway is clear: keto’s fat-centric approach can strain a compromised liver, potentially worsening conditions like NAFLD or cirrhosis. Prioritize liver health by opting for diets that minimize fat metabolism demands. Always seek medical guidance tailored to your specific condition, as one-size-fits-all approaches rarely apply here.

Those with eating disorders: Restrictive diets like keto can trigger disordered eating patterns
For individuals with a history of eating disorders, the keto diet's rigid macronutrient restrictions can act as a dangerous catalyst. This high-fat, low-carbohydrate approach, while effective for some, mirrors the black-and-white thinking often associated with disordered eating. The strict limitations on food groups and the intense focus on macronutrient ratios can reignite obsessive behaviors, leading to a resurgence of harmful patterns like calorie counting, food avoidance, and an unhealthy preoccupation with "clean" eating.
A 2018 study published in the *Journal of Eating Disorders* found that individuals with a history of anorexia nervosa who attempted low-carb diets were more likely to experience a relapse in symptoms compared to those following a balanced diet. This highlights the potential for keto to exacerbate existing vulnerabilities.
Imagine a recovering anorexia patient meticulously tracking every gram of carbohydrate, fearing even the slightest deviation from the prescribed limits. The keto diet's emphasis on ketosis, achieved through severe carbohydrate restriction, can easily morph into a new set of rules to rigidly adhere to, replacing one set of unhealthy restrictions with another. This shift can be particularly insidious, as it may initially appear as a "healthy" choice, masking the underlying disordered eating patterns.
It's crucial to understand that recovery from eating disorders involves rebuilding a healthy relationship with food, one that embraces flexibility and variety. The keto diet's inherent rigidity directly contradicts this goal. Instead of focusing on restriction, individuals in recovery should prioritize intuitive eating, listening to their body's hunger and fullness cues, and enjoying a diverse range of foods without guilt or fear.
If you or someone you know has a history of eating disorders, it's imperative to consult with a qualified healthcare professional before considering any restrictive diet like keto. A registered dietitian specializing in eating disorders can provide personalized guidance, ensuring nutritional needs are met while supporting long-term recovery and a healthy relationship with food. Individuals with kidney disease: High protein intake in keto may exacerbate kidney problems
Kidney disease patients often face a delicate balance in managing their diet to prevent further complications. The keto diet, with its emphasis on high protein and fat intake, can pose significant risks for this vulnerable group. Here's why: the kidneys play a crucial role in filtering waste products from protein metabolism, and a high-protein diet increases their workload. For individuals with already compromised kidney function, this additional strain can accelerate the progression of kidney damage.
Consider the mechanism: when protein is metabolized, it produces waste products like urea, which the kidneys must filter and excrete. In a healthy individual, this process is efficient. However, for someone with kidney disease, the reduced renal function struggles to keep up with the increased waste load. Studies suggest that a high-protein diet can elevate glomerular filtration rate (GFR) and increase albuminuria, markers of kidney stress and potential decline. For instance, a protein intake above 1.2 g/kg/day has been associated with worsened kidney function in patients with chronic kidney disease (CKD).
From a practical standpoint, individuals with kidney disease should approach the keto diet with extreme caution. If considering keto, they must consult a nephrologist or dietitian to tailor protein intake to their specific renal function. Generally, protein intake should be moderated to 0.6–0.8 g/kg/day for CKD patients, significantly lower than the typical keto recommendation of 1.5–2.0 g/kg/day. Additionally, prioritizing plant-based proteins over animal sources can reduce the phosphorus load, another concern for kidney health.
The takeaway is clear: while keto may offer benefits for some, it is not a one-size-fits-all solution. For those with kidney disease, the potential risks far outweigh the rewards. Instead, a renal-friendly diet focusing on controlled protein intake, adequate hydration, and balanced macronutrients is recommended.
